New door installation in Opa-locka is rarely a simple swap. Most homes in ZIP 33054 need structural assessment first — the 1950s-1970s framing around the garage opening often lacks the anchoring depth required for modern wind-rated doors. We inspect the jambs, header, and concrete attachment points before quoting. A typical single-car replacement on a Cairo Lane or Sultan Avenue CBS home runs $825–$1,895, while double-car installations with reinforced framing range $1,450–$2,595. Every quote includes the Miami-Dade NOA-certified door, hardware rated for 150+ mph, and permit-ready documentation.

Single-car garages dominate Opa-locka’s residential blocks — these were working-class homes built for families with one vehicle, and the 8-foot or 9-foot openings often measure slightly off-standard due to decades of settling, stucco buildup, or informal modifications. We don’t force a stock door into a non-standard opening. James measures twice, orders or cuts to fit, and reinforces the framing so the door holds when the next tropical system rolls through. Steel doors are the practical choice for most Opa-locka single-car installations — they resist the humidity and UV that warp wood in this climate.

Double-car installations in Opa-locka are less common in the residential core but appear in the small multi-family and duplex stock near Bunche Park, plus newer infill construction. The wider opening means more wind-load surface area, which demands heavier-duty track, reinforced struts, and often a beefier opener. We typically spec Clopay or Amarr wind-rated doors with 14-gauge or 12-gauge steel construction for these spans. If your double-car door is failing, we’ll tell you straight whether the track system can be salvaged or if full replacement is the smarter long-term play.

Steel doors are our default recommendation for most Opa-locka installations. The combination of Biscayne Bay salt air, extreme humidity, and intense UV punishes wood and uncoated metals faster here than in inland Florida markets. Modern steel doors — Clopay’s 425 series, Amarr’s Stratford line, Wayne Dalton’s 8300 series — carry baked-on finishes and galvanized substrates that hold up. We stock common sizes and can source Miami-Dade NOA-rated steel doors in 24-48 hours for most Opa-locka jobs.

Wood doors have their place in Opa-locka — mostly on architecturally sensitive restorations or homeowner association-mandated replacements. We install them, but we’re direct about the maintenance reality: annual sealing, vigilance for rot at the bottom rail, and shorter functional lifespan in this climate. When we do wood, we spec moisture-resistant species and upgraded hardware to compensate. Most Opa-locka customers choose steel once they understand the trade-offs.

Common Garage Door Installation Problems We See in Opa-locka Homes

  • Non-compliant doors on pre-Andrew homes. We regularly find original single-panel or early sectional doors on 1950s-1970s CBS homes that have no Miami-Dade NOA and won’t pass inspection. Installing a new door without verifying NOA compliance is a costly mistake — we’ve been called in to replace doors that other contractors installed, only to have the homeowner’s insurance or resale inspection flag the violation.
  • Hidden track corrosion near OPF and coastal-ingress zones. Salt air pushed inland from Biscayne Bay accelerates rust on vertical tracks and bottom brackets, especially on doors that haven’t been maintained. The corrosion isn’t always visible until the door is removed. We inspect every component during installation and replace compromised hardware — reusing a pitted track on a new wind-rated door defeats the purpose.
  • Undersized or modified framing. Decades of informal repairs, stucco additions, and header notching have left many Opa-locka garage openings structurally inadequate for modern wind-rated doors. We see this on almost every third job in the older residential core. James assesses the header span, jamb attachment, and concrete embedment depth, then specifies reinforcement before the door goes up.
  • Failed commercial operators after tropical weather. The industrial corridor near Opa-locka Executive Airport packs a high density of commercial roll-up and sectional doors into a small area. After tropical storms, we see a disproportionate surge in calls — older seals leak, motorized operators short from moisture intrusion, and wind-stressed panels derail. Preventive replacement of aging commercial systems before storm season is cheaper than emergency repair after.

Pricing for Garage Door Installation in Opa-locka, FL

Here’s what garage door installation costs in Opa-locka’s market — real numbers, not “call for pricing” bait-and-switch:

Service Typical Range in Opa-locka
New Door Installation $825–$2,595
Single Car Door (wind-rated, installed) $825–$1,895
Double Car Door (wind-rated, installed) $1,450–$2,595
Custom Garage Door (fabricated to opening) $1,800–$2,595+
Steel Door (standard wind-rated) $825–$1,950
Wood Door (premium, with maintenance package) $1,400–$2,400
Structural Framing Reinforcement (if needed) $200–$650

What moves the needle within these ranges? Door size, insulation level, window inserts, opener inclusion, and whether your existing framing needs reinforcement. Every Opa-locka home is different — especially the older CBS stock with non-standard openings. We provide exact, itemized quotes before any work begins.
